Vinification
Gentle handling of the fruit to ensure freshness, texture and depth.
I harvest in the cool of night, ferment in open vessels with hand
plunging or gentle pumping over to ensure even maceration,
press gently, and run to aged American oak barrels for
natural malo-lactic fermentation.

Region Notes
Grapes are sourced from our Langhorne Creek "Kilpuruna' vineyard.
With warm days & cool nights, Langhorne Creek provides ideal
growing conditions for this gluggable grape variety.
